Abstract
A method of simultaneously recording multiple reference magnetic signals by using a magnetic head having multiple recording portions is provided. A writing yoke formed of a ferromagnetic material thin film and a back yoke are provided to a side wall of a slider, which is formed of a hard ceramic, as a distal end portion of the magnetic head. After forming the yokes to the slider, grooves are formed by focused ion beam machining from the slider side. All of the materials of the slider, the back yoke, and the writing yoke are thus locally removed. Magnetic writing is thus blocked by the grooves, and magnetic recording is only performed by four recording portions of the writing yoke.
